Abstract
Nahwu science is a linguistic study in which there is a discussion of the most basic rules of the Arabic language. According to history, Ali bin Abi Talib and Abu Aswad ad-Du'ali were the originators of Nahwu science. There is another opinion that says Abdur Rahman Hurmuz al-A'raj and Nasr Asim were the originators of Nahwu science. However, this opinion is not strong, so the majority of scholars agree that ad-Du'ali was the originator of Nahwu science after Ali bin Abi Talib because he was the first to give meaning to the Al-Qur'an. There are two factors behind the emergence of Nahwu science, namely religious and socio-cultural factors. In its development, Nahwu science developed into five schools, namely Basrah, Kufa, Baghdad, Andalusia and Egypt. In Indonesia, Nahwu science is a science for learning Arabic. Nahwu knowledge plays an important role in learning Arabic, because it is used to understand sentence structures using harakat.
